Photo contest: "Toys and Hobbies"
« on: June 09, 2010, 10:28:14 AM »
I would like to announce a new photo contest called "Toys and Hobbies".

The idea is to submit interesting photos of toys or hobbies, to represent to the forum members your achievement in a particular hobby area, or try to promote it to other members using photographs only. Or just have fun  8)
Both crafts and arts count, photography counts too, although photos must be related to the hobby subject. Toys may be pictured in any context, but should remain the primary subject of the composition.

Images should be submitted to the dedicated album in the forum gallery and then included in a reply to this topic together with a short description.

Submission deadline is the end of June 2010.
Forum members will be able to vote by replying to the same topic.
Voting starts July and ends July 15th.
Prize will be something small, but useful, I have not decided it yet.

Edit:
I am adding 15 more days to the deadline for submitting photos; it now ends July 15th and voting will take place after that till the end of July.
See if this attracts more participants: The prize will be a USD 50 gift voucher for a web store of your choice or just USD 50 transfered to your Paypal account.
This is how high I can go for the moment.

Just in case: All photos submitted must be appropriate for minors. Participants are responsible for the contents of their photographs. Contest may be cancelled at any time or photographs deleted from the site without warning.

my hobby is modding and adapting for my ep1 and  gf1
especially adapters for lenses  which are  not available
this photo shows 3 projects converged in a single photo
lens cap adapter for hanamex 20 mm f4 underwater fixed focus lens for 110 underwater cameras optimized for better perf at 3 - 40 feet
it a little better than the stock fixed focus that usually  commmits to infinity , i guess the lens designed optimized for underwater working distances, its a reall fun toy  decent focus for most needs , has working diaphram  to 4 to perhaps f16 with everything in between


second is the gear in the lower area it meshes exactly with the wheel focus  for a 1st gen contax g to m4\3 adapter , doubling the focus speed [ from gear ratios] and giving a better tactile focus experence with these lenses both  the contax g 45 and 90 work very well with it

lastly an ebony grip carved and fitted to an oly everyready case it is meant to look like tree bark glued  from the from  screwed from the back ground smooth to not scratch my ep1


seen from the top i believe this is the shallowest fully functional lens ever made for the ep1\gf1
